Early Life and Education
- Born: April 29, 1843, in Areia, Brazil
- Died: October 7, 1905
- Pedro Américo de Figueiredo e Melo displayed artistic talent from a young age, considered a child prodigy.
- He participated as a draftsman on an expedition of naturalists through the Brazilian Northeast, receiving government support for his studies.
- Furthered his education in Paris, studying with renowned painters and also dedicating himself to science and philosophy.
Artistic Style and Major Works
- Pedro Américo's style fused neoclassical, romantic, and realistic elements, establishing him as a key figure in Brazilian academic painting.
- His works are characterized by their historical significance and enduring presence in the national imagination.
- Notable Works:
- Batalha de Avaí (Battle of Avai) - Depicts a pivotal battle in Brazilian history.
- Fala do Trono (Speech from the Throne) – A portrayal of imperial power and ceremony.
- Independência ou Morte! (Independence or Death!) – Captures a dramatic moment of national significance.
- Tiradentes Esquartejado (Tiradentes Quartered) - Illustrates a tragic event in Brazilian history, showcasing the brutality of colonial rule.
- In the later part of his career, he shifted towards oriental, allegorical, and biblical themes.
Influences and Development
- Early exposure to art through family members fostered a passion for drawing from a young age.
- Studies in Paris exposed him to European artistic traditions, particularly neoclassical and romantic styles.
- His scientific pursuits influenced his approach to realism, emphasizing accuracy and detail in his depictions.
- Pedro Américo’s work reflects the broader cultural and political context of 19th-century Brazil, including its aspirations for modernization and nation-building.
Legacy and Historical Significance
- Pedro Américo is considered one of the most important academic painters in Brazilian history.
- His paintings are celebrated for their artistic merit and historical importance, often serving as visual representations of key moments in Brazil's past.
- He left a significant written legacy on aesthetics, art history, and philosophy, emphasizing education’s role in progress.
- Despite facing criticism from avant-garde movements for his adherence to academic traditions, Pedro Américo remains a pivotal figure in Brazilian culture.

Recognition and Honors
- Historical Painter of the Imperial Chamber
- Order of the Rose
- Order of the Holy Sepulchre
- Bachelor of Arts in Social Sciences from the Sorbonne
- PhD in Natural Sciences from the Free University of Brussels
